What is an addictive or psychoactive drug? An addictive or psychoactive drug is a substance such as heroin, crack, crystal meth, norco, adderall, amytal etc... that works primarily upon the central nervous system where it alters brain function, which results in momentary changes in perception, mood, alertness and behavior. Addictive drugs also change the personalities of the individuals that use them and these changes in personality and behavior are usually very detrimental and troublesome. When a person initially uses a psychoactive drug they typically feel a false sense of euphoria caused by the substance. When repeated daily for an extended amount of time the person will develop an addiction to the substance. Addiction will usually be a tremendous tragedy in a persons life. Nobody intends to produce this nightmare, known as addiction, on themselves, rather the person was simply ignorant of the harmful consequences where they could only see the pleasure it seemed to bring in the beginning and they thought it would always be like that.

Shoreline Treatment Center is a treatment facility licensed by the state of Texas to treat adolescents with substance abuse disorders. Shoreline offers treatment to boys and girls aged 13-17 who have problems with alcohol and other drugs.

Alpha Home offers dual diagnosis support for women who suffer from substance abuse and mental health issues. By providing gender-specific treatment in a nurturing environment, our program encourages women to focus on female specific issues. Over the course of the program, women are immersed in the 12 step program and are helped with important life skills, a combination that allows them to find sobriety and the courage to maintain it after they leave treatment.
